Characteristics of perfect competition:

The following characteristics are essential for the existence of Perfect Competition: -

  • Large Number of Buyers and Sellers.
  • Homogeneity of the Product.
  • Free Entry and Exit of Firms.
  • Perfect Knowledge of the Market.
  • Perfect Mobility of the Factors of Production and Goods.
  • Absence of Price Control.
